If it is a single piece of furniture that fits easily through the front door and goes on the main floor with no …The first option is to pay a percentage of the delivery fee. Most people settle on 10 to 15 percent of the price of the delivery fee. This is done if you have to order the delivery separately and pay for it. If the weather is particularly bad, tip 20 percent. You're not just paying for a service; you're acknowledging the person who delivered it.That's not true, the delivery team doesn't get paid for any labor nor do the get the $80 for in home deliveries or the $50 for drive way deliveries. The owner of the Delivery company gets the fees and the team is paid day salary. They get paid the same if they work 6:30am to 6:30pm if they are day salary. Here's what to know about tipping for furniture delivery.Business Insider recommends tipping $5 per professional for furniture delivered and $10 for the delivery of a large item, such as an appliance. They suggest a larger tip of $20 if exceptional service was provided.
